Output 376b690d62ea681fbb4cf4a30ca2f6f11c11b5b50245122461f13426720a8dc7:3

value
102790154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d6bad520b5bf65897e578b09c1435624de2a021 OP_EQUAL
address
MAaipXPKdEpc2zEeoh6yxJd6rEBfMcigYg
transaction
376b690d62ea681fbb4cf4a30ca2f6f11c11b5b50245122461f13426720a8dc7
spent
true